1. Pre-approved course to replace a grade where a <strong>student</strong> failed. Only the initial failing grade is<br />

applied toward the cumulative grade point average, but credit will be awarded for the<br />

repeated course on the official transcript.<br />

2. Students may retake an <strong>Oldenburg</strong> <strong>Academy</strong> course offered by the <strong>Academy</strong> if he/she wants<br />

to improve knowledge of specific course content. Only the initial grade and credit will be<br />

applied to the official transcript and cumulative grade point average.<br />

• Students must earn a passing grade for each semester to receive full credit for a course.<br />

• <strong>Oldenburg</strong> <strong>Academy</strong> follows the State of Indiana’s requirements for Academic Honors Diploma<br />

(see page <strong>12</strong>).<br />
